07 P-71 tranny delay going into drive
after the delay it works fine when we got the car there was a pretty good size dent in the fluid pan we changed the filter and fluid and the selonoids and it still takes about 4 seconds to go into drive any help would really help .

Re: 07 P-71 tranny delay going into drive
Does it slip during any shift (i.e. engine 'flares' during shift)? Sounds like a low pressure issue. If you changed the filter, make sure that the seal from the old one was not stuck in the valve body. Does it make any growling or whining sounds in gear?
